Gas explosions are a major threat in hydrocarbon production facilities to loss of life and asset integrity. For any explosion to occur there must be an associated ignition source present during a gas release.

Electrical and Instrumentation equipment provide the most common source of ignition unless the equipment is correctly installed and maintained.

The International Electrical Commission standard IEC 60079 provides guidance on correct installation and maintenance of the above equipment and recommends a 3-year interval between periodic independent inspections of such equipment to ensure safe operation within a hydrocarbon environment.

OUR EX INSPECTION INCLUDE IN SCOPE OF WORK:

Carry out the inspection for all Ex devices/equipment specified in the provided register follow the requirement of standard IEC-60079.

 Check and verify the Ex certificate/dossier of all Ex devices /  equipment  specified in the provided register for compliance with standard IEC-60079 and to make sure that equipment is correctly selected for intended hazardous area that equipment located.

 Submit the weekly progress report showing the quantity & percentage of inspected equipment.

 With regard to the Ex device/equipment which have not been specified in the provided Register, we carry out the inspection and update in the final Hazardous Area Equipment Register.

 Issue the Final Inspection dossier which includes minimum below documents: Summary report showing the overview of the inspection result, Hazardous Area Equipment Register based on the actual result of Inspection & verification., detailed inspection check list follow the requirement of IEC 60079 for each device/ enclosure equipment, Issue the Certificate of compliance of ICE 60079 standard  for installation of all Ex devices/ Equipment  project, Master punch list and recommendation how to close the punch items.
